FAQ: How do I upgrade the Quenlar message broker safely?

For the release manager: drain consumers first, snapshot the broker state, then roll nodes one at a time, verifying replication lag stays under two seconds. Never skip a minor version. If the cluster fails to form quorum after the upgrade, restore from the snapshot; the restore tool will ask for the recovery passphrase noted below.

strongbox words: alddor-rusius-belox-gorys-holius-oliix-ralmir-lamvan-briius-fraion-zormir-novwyn-zormir-holmir

**Vendor note: Inkmill markdown pipeline**

Rendering for Parchway docs is outsourced to Inkmill under an annual contract, renewing each March. They handle sanitization and PDF export; we own the upload queue. SLA: 4-hour response on rendering failures. Escalate only after two failed retries. Their support desk is reachable at the address below.

billing contact of hahaf-baguf = zorael.tammir.jorius@sivrelhq.internal

Subject: Slim-image cut-over done ✅

Hi all,

Quick recap for the newer folks: we finished moving the Pondskater services off the old 1.8 GB base image onto the slimmed build. Images are now under 140 MB, pulls are way faster, and deploy times dropped by about two-thirds. A few tools you might expect (curl, vim) are gone from the containers on purpose — use the debug sidecar instead. The new builds ship with the following configuration values baked in:

service settings:
[briius]
port = 3000
region = outer-1
host = briius.zarqeldyn.internal
team = wenael
timeout_ms = 2000
retries = 5

POST /v2/fanout enqueues notification batches. When downstream delivery lags, the Splitwren gateway returns 429 with a retry-after header; clients must honor it or risk queue eviction. Backpressure thresholds are set per-tenant in the Larkmoor config service and are not overridable at request time. All calls to the staging fan-out endpoint must present the bearer token below.

session JWT of yawep-yawep = eyJhbGciOiJIUzI1NiIsInR5cCI6IkpXVCJ9.eyJzdWIiOiI3pWF3_In0.aXYsHiog